Hey — the driver-assignment heuristic in Routabout started failing overnight because the credentials for the internal DistanceGrid service expired. Assignments are falling back to naive nearest-driver, which is tanking our batching stats. I already requested a fresh key from the platform folks and it's been issued; you just need to drop it into the heuristic worker's config and redeploy. For now, the new DistanceGrid key is pasted below.

gateway credential: kto3_qfe

Ticket: Config drift on LoomLocker access flow

Support noticed that the PIN-entry step at the Brindlemere site behaves differently from staging: retries lock the hatch after three attempts instead of five, and the grace timer is shorter. Comparing environments shows the site was never updated after the Q3 rollout. For reference, the values currently live on the Brindlemere controller are as follows.

service settings:
JORDOR_PIN=4957
JORDOR_TENANT=julox
JORDOR_METRICS_HOST=metrics.jordor.crelvostack.corp
JORDOR_SEAL=seal_62a7566e
JORDOR_STANDBY_TEAM=rusir

- [ ] Step 7: Archive cold storage buckets (Glacierline tier). Confirm both ceremony witnesses are present, verify bucket manifests match the Oxbow ledger, then seal the archive key shares. Plugin authors may observe but not handle shares. Once sealed, the archive index itself is encrypted and can only be reopened with the passphrase below.

vault phrase of badup-hahig = tamael-aldael-kelmir-istael-fenok-istwyn-tamius-jorath-oliion

DeployDrake is our chat bot for deploy status. It posts build results and rollout progress to the ops channel and answers /status queries. Release managers run it locally when testing new announcement formats. Clone the repo, run make setup, and create a .env file in the root. The bot cannot connect to the chat gateway without its token, so add this line first:

env line for fafof-fahag: LEDGER_TOKEN5=f8790